Chocolate Snack Cake

Prep: 10 min Cook: 35 min Serves: 9 Cuisine: American

A moist, rich chocolate snack cake with deep cocoa flavor, perfect for quick treats or potlucks, appealing to chocolate lovers seeking an easy, satisfying dessert.

Ingredients

  • 1 2/3 cups flour
  • 1 cup firmly packed br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up cocoa
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on vinegar
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la

Instructions

  1. Heat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Mix flour, brown sugar, cocoa, baking soda, and salt with a fork in an ungreased 8 x 8 x 2-inch square pan.
  3. Add water, vegetable oil, vinegar, and vanilla to the dry ingredients and mix well.
  4. Bake until a wooden pick inserted in the center comes out clean, about 35 to 40 minutes.
  5. Dust with powdered sugar if desired.

Tips & Substitutions

To enhance the chocolate flavor, consider adding a teaspoon of instant coffee granules to the dry ingredients. If you need a gluten-free option, swap the all-purpose flour for a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end. For a richer cake, you can replace some of the water with brewed coffee. Keep an eye on the baking time, as ovens can vary.

Serving Suggestions

This chocolate snack cake is delightful on its own but can be served with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for added indulgence. Pair it with a cup of coffee or a Waterfront Cooler for a refreshing contrast. For a festive touch, dust with powdered sugar or top with fresh berries.

Storage & Reheating

Allow the cake to cool completely before storing.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and keep it at room temperature for up to three days. For longer storage, refrigerate for up to a week. To reheat, warm individual slices in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ds, or enjoy it cold.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use unsweetened cocoa powder instead of regular cocoa?

Yes, unsweetened cocoa powder works perfectly in this recipe. It will provide a rich chocolate flavor without added sweetness, which is ideal since the brown sugar contributes the necessary sweetness.

Is it possible to make this cake in advance?

Absolutely! You can bake the cake a day in advance. Just ensure it is completely cooled before wrapping it. It maintains its taste and texture well, making it a great option for parties or gatherings.

Can I add chocolate chips to the batter?

Definitely! Adding 1/2 to 1 cup of chocolate chips to the batter will make the cake even more decadent. Just fold them in after mixing the wet and dry ingredients for an extra chocolatey treat.
